    At that price bracket, Salisbury East would be my pick. Rental vacancy is ultra tight with currently only 6 properties available for rent on RE.com. check out the pocket between and around the Grove way and Clayson Rd. It has a new local shopping centre on saints Rd and is a central 5 min drive to 3 major shopping centres, Elizabeth/Parabanks/Golden Grove. Also 10 mins to Tea tree plaza. There are also 2 large schools side by side, Tyndale and Salisbury high. It also has Cobbler Creek recreation park with hiking and mountain bike trails. Convenient public transport access along main nth Rd and is a 30 min drive to the Adelaide CBD. This area packs alot of convenience and borders Salisbury hts that has been fetching some impressive prices as of late.

    There’s some lovely old heritage buildings in the main bit of town , but can’t see it having increased demand any time soon. Influx of new housing estates around Evanston , Virginia , angle vale etc means there’s supply side of the equation for years

    Cross keys Rd cuts through a commercial/industrial zone, and has a considerable amount of heavy vehicle traffic. I lived directly under a flight path of Parafield airport for many years, and had no issue with the amont of noise. Having said that, it is my understanding the council does receive alot of complaints from residents about it.
